Ku-ring-gai is bound by three national parks - Garigal National Park, Lane Cove National Park, and Ku-ring-gai Chase National Park.
Ku-ring-gai lists six endangered ecological communities including two listed as critically endangered - The Blue Gum High Forest and the Sydney Turpentine Ironbark Forest. Humans have degraded much of these native environments through land clearing, rezoning for development, poisoning individual trees etc. We must do more to protect our rare urban forests before their flora and fauna become extinct.
Clearing and loss of vegetation for development is rapidly expediting their extinction.
